MUMBAI, India, June 26 -- Intellectual Property India has published a patent application (202617035800 A) filed by Arcactive Limited on March 24, 2026, for Lead Acid Battery Management System.

Inventors include Mckenzie, Stuart; Christie, Shane; and Holmberg, Eric Scott.

The application for the patent was published on June 19, 2026, under issue no. 25/2026.

Abstract: A Lead-Acid Battery Management System (BMS) and a method for operating a BMS for a battery system comprising a plurality of groups of at least one lead acid battery, the battery management system comprising: at least one control device configured to electrically integrate and segregate each of the batteries from the string, and a controller configured to control the control device to independently control the charging and discharging of each of the batteries. In some cases the controller is configured to determine an input power available to charge the battery system, determine, based on the determined input power, that at least one of the groups of batteries can charge above a charging threshold; and selectively charge at least one of the groups of at least one battery. In some cases the BMS is configured overcharge the batteries independently. In some cases the BMS is configured to modify the discharging of the at least one battery based in a determined charge characteristic.
